Powder coating provides exceptional resistance to chipping on metal urban outdoor furniture due to its thermosetting polymer formulation that creates a durable, flexible finish. Unlike traditional liquid paints, powder coating undergoes an electrostatic application process followed by heat curing, resulting in a uniform layer that bonds chemically to the metal substrate. This creates a surface that typically withstands impact from debris, tools, and environmental stresses without flaking or chipping.
The chip resistance is measured through standardized tests like ASTM D3170, where most quality powder coatings achieve ratings of 4B-5B (excellent adhesion) after cross-hatch testing. Urban furniture manufacturers often use polyester-based powders with UV stabilizers that maintain flexibility between -60°F to 200°F, preventing brittle fractures in seasonal changes. Typical thickness ranges from 2-8 mils (50-200 microns) – substantially thicker than liquid coatings – providing greater impact absorption.
Environmental factors influence performance: coastal salt exposure may reduce resistance by 15-20% compared to inland urban settings. Proper surface preparation including phosphating or chromating before coating application is critical for maximum chip resistance. With adequate maintenance, powder-coated urban furniture typically retains chip resistance for 10-15 years before requiring recoating.
